Spring into Andover for family fun this Easter!




Saturday 16 April


Andover town centre will be buzzing with family-friendly activities on Saturday 16 April.


Test Valley Borough Council is organising this FREE event to make the most of the Easter weekend, with plenty for you to enjoy across the centre of town. Take a look at what's happening below:


Easter Trail, 10am - 3pm

Town Centre


Children will have lots fun taking part in the Easter trail, simply pick up and entry form at the Chantry Centre and search for hidden characters across the town centre for the chance to win a prize. There will be plenty of opportunities to stop and make the most of the other free activities along the way.


Children's Crafts, 10am - 3pm

Chantry Centre


Inside the Chantry Centre children can take part in free spring-themed craft workshops between 10am -3pm, to help make a colourful piece of artwork for the centre and take their own creations home. This workshops will take place in the garden area next to Boswell’s café.


Animal Farm, 11am -2pm

Riverside Park, near Town Mills


Animal lovers of all ages will enjoy meeting animals at the mobile farm, which will be located in the new Riverside Park, by Town Mills - just opposite the Chantry Centre car park. Open 11am - 2pm.


Garden Games, 10am - 3pm

Riverside Park, near Town Mills


Also in the park, a selection of outdoor games will be available for families and friends to play and test their competitive skills.


Live Music, 10am -3pm

High Street


InAndover will be arranging live music in the Time Ring to entertain everyone in the town.


Entertainers


There will also be special entertainers popping up in the Chantry Centre and Riverside Park to delight visitors throughout the day.
